Ashlea

ASHLEA STUBBINS LANE, HIGH PEAK

Prices from 55.0 per night.

Ashlea is a newly built 2 storey holiday home which is attached to the owners detached property. It is completely self contained with its own front door accessed from the lane through the single gate. It has underfloor heating throughout fitted kitchen lounge bedroom sleeps two adults with twin oak beds (no children allowed) and a beautiful modern bathroom with full size bath and wet area shower.Positioned on a quiet lane with Cracken Edge on our doorstep we have an elevated position in addition we have far reaching views from our south facing private balcony at the rear of the property looking towards Eccles Pike and beyond. Plenty of parking available on the lane.Ideal For Walkers Cyclists and a perfect retreat for Business or Leisure stays.There are abundabce of WalksCycle routes available taking in some of the High Peaks unique villages.The property is within a short stroll of the villages local amenities and has a direct train route to the cosmopolitan cities of Manchester and Sheffield yet is situated close to some of The Peak Districts most stunning scenery.The ground floor accommodation consists of a fitted kitchen with oven hob hood fridgefreezer table and chairs crockery glassware and cutlery.The south facing living room has a leather suite with remote control reclining facility a wall mounted TV with free view DVD player CDradio player Ipod docking station and a private south facing balcony with table and chairs.Upstairs the bedroom has twin oak beds for 2 adults fitted wardrobe bedside tables and lamps. A fully tiled bathroom with full size bath WC large modern sink fitted into an oak cabinet shower wet area bed linen bath and hand towels.The whole of the property has underfloor heating run from an air source heat pump.In the evening why not relax and have a stroll down into the village and visit The Old Hall at Whitehough this 16th Century Inn with its Minstrel gallery is a great country pub with an award winning selection of local ales and fabulous food.

Hawthorn Farm

Fairfield Common Fairfield Road, Buxton

Prices from 120.0 per night.

Hawthorn Farm is a grade two listed house dating from before 1580 the house was converted into a guest house over 70 years ago. We have two rooms in the main house and a further six rooms in the converted cow sheds. We have en-suite shower facilities with all our rooms and a two room suite with private shower room and additional toilet. All the rooms have flat screen digital tv tea and coffee making facilities alarm clocks and hair dryers. Some of our rooms are pet friendly only two dogs at a time and by arrangement only please.( Email or phone to check first.) There is a 69 par golf course virtually on our door step which offers discounts to our guests. An all weather driving range is also next door to them.We also have a local leisure center with swimming pool sauna steam room and fully equipped gym that allows our guest to use it's facilities for £5 per day.
